Join ABDSP Superintendent Mark Jorgensen on a two-week tour of the Gobi Desert of Mongolia!
Stay in a ger (yurt) camp in Hustai National Park, home to Przewalskii horses, Red Deer (much like the elk of North America) and other wildlife. Look for Argali sheep at our Sister Park, the Ikh Nart Nature Reserve, and learn about the wildlife research being conducted there. Explore grasslands, sand dunes, and steppes habitat.

Tour Highlights:

  • Two days in capital city Ulaanbaatar for museums, shopping, and a folk concert (hotel accommodations).Mongolian gers under a full moon
  • Two nights and days in Hustai National Park for wildlife viewing, including Przewalskii Horses (ger camp accommodations).
  • Two nights at Arburd Sands Ger Camp, exploring grasslands and sand dunes, looking for wildlife and visiting a local nomadic family.
  • Three days and nights in and around Ikh Nart Nature Reserve, "sister park" to Anza-Borrego Desert State Park (Ger Camp).
  • Visit a local village on the way to Gun Galuut Nature Reserve, ideal for birdwatching in steppes habitat (Ger Camp accommodations).
  • Two days and nights at Jalman Meadows (Ger camp), including a float trip down the Tuul River on rafts.

Most accommodations are in rustic ger (yurt) camps, with very simple facilities. All meals outside of Ulaanbaatar are included.Participants are responsible for making their own travel arrangements to and from Ulaanbaatar.

Please note: this trip is not for the luxury traveler or the faint-hearted! Food and facilities are very basic, in locations that are quite remote. Participants should be in excellent health, with a sense of adventure and desire to experience a new culture.
